Troubleshooting Issues with IP Address 111.09.150.182
Troubleshooting issues related to the IP address 111.09.150.182 can be essential for maintaining connectivity and ensuring a seamless online experience. When encountering problems, the first step is to diagnose any connectivity issues. Begin by checking whether the device using this IP address is properly connected to the network. This includes verifying if the cables are securely attached or if the Wi-Fi network is functioning correctly.
Next, proceed to check the IP configuration on the device. This can typically be done by accessing the device’s network settings. Ensure that the IP address 111.09.150.182 is assigned correctly and that there are no typing errors. Confirm that the subnet mask and default gateway are set in accordance with the network rules. An incorrect configuration can lead to connectivity problems, as devices need to communicate through proper addressing.
If the IP address appears to be configured correctly yet problems persist, consider the possibility of IP address conflicts. This occurs when two devices on the same network are assigned the same IP address, which can lead to connectivity issues for both devices. To resolve this, check the connected devices to identify any duplicates. Reassign a different IP address to the conflicting device and reboot both devices to refresh their connections.
